Price of residing disaster raises fears of surge in on-line baby exploitation this summer season
Young folks may very well be left at larger threat from on-line exploitation as households battle to afford actions reminiscent of days out and vacation golf equipment this summer season, kids's charities have warned.The NSPCC mentioned the price of residing disaster should not be allowed to "fuel another surge in abuse" as occurred throughout the COVID pandemic, whereas Barnardo's warned: "What starts in the virtual world can quickly move to in-person sexual and criminal exploitation."
Barnardo's mentioned its polling of 1,191 dad and mom and carers throughout Great Britain recommended virtually half (46%) will battle to come up with the money for household holidays and days out.1 / 4 (26%) mentioned they can't pay for actions like childcare and vacation golf equipment, and ...
